sample{font-size:var(--21px)}@font-face{font-family:"Zen Kaku Gothic New", sans-serif;font-weight:400;font-style:normal}.siteHeadContainer{display:none}.siteHeader{box-shadow:none;min-height:auto;position:relative;width:100%;height:100%;background:#FFFBDA}.illust1{width:120px;margin-top:50px;animation:floating-y 2.7s ease-in-out infinite alternate-reverse}@keyframes floating-y{0%{transform:translateY(-3%)}100%{transform:translateY(3%)}}.navi{margin:0;padding:0;z-index:99;color:#7e4400;font-family:"Zen Kaku Gothic New", sans-serif;font-weight:600}.navi li{letter-spacing:0.5}.sns{display:flex;height:30px}.sns img{width:100%;margin-top:10px;padding:0 0.8rem 0rem 0rem;padding-left:0;height:35px}.siteFooter{border:none;background-color:#ED9455;height:50px;text-align:center;padding:15px 0}.top-contents{width:100%;height:auto;display:flex}.sitetop-logo{width:100px;margin-bottom:30px}.header{width:20%;padding-left:5vw;padding-top:2%}.top_kv{width:80%;position:relative;display:flex;justify-content:flex-end}.top_kv img{width:100%;border-bottom-left-radius:50px;object-fit:cover}a{color:#7e4400;transition:0.5s}a:hover{color:#ED9455;transition:0.5s;text-decoration:none}li{list-style:none}h2,.h3,.h4,.h5,.h6,.mainSection-title,h3,h4,h5,h6{margin:1rem 0 auto}p{line-height:1.6rem;margin:0;padding:0}.kita{width:100%;margin:0 auto;background:#FFFBDA;color:#7e4400;font-size:1rem;font-family:"Zen Kaku Gothic New", sans-serif}.loop-wrap{width:100%;background:linear-gradient(180deg, #FFFBDA 0%, #FFFBDA 30%, #FFEC9E 30%, #FFEC9E 100%);background-repeat:no-repeat}.post-loop{width:80%;display:flex;justify-content:center;margin:0 auto;padding:2rem 0 0rem}.post-one{display:flex;flex-direction:column;justify-content:center;padding:2vw;margin:auto}.post-loop-con:nth-child(2),.post-loop-con:nth-child(4){margin:-2rem auto}.post_photo{position:relative;background-color:#fff;width:100%;height:auto;text-align:center;transition:0.5s}.post_photo:hover{background-color:#fff;animation:bounce 0.4s ease-out}.post_photo img{width:100%;border:10px solid;border-color:#fcfcfc;box-shadow:0px 0px 5px rgba(0, 0, 0, 0.2)}.ribbon{display:inline-block;position:absolute;top:0px;left:0px;margin:10px 0 0 10px;padding:0px 0 0 10px;z-index:2;width:60px;text-align:center;color:white;font-size:1rem;background:#ED9455;border-radius:2px 0 0 0;text-align:left}.ribbon:after{position:absolute;content:"";width:0px;height:0px;z-index:1}.ribbon:after{top:0;right:0;border-width:15px 7.5px 15px 0px;border-color:transparent #fff transparent transparent;border-style:solid}@keyframes bounce{0%{transform:translate(0, 0)}49.8%{transform:translate(0, -14px);animation-timing-function:ease-in}100%{transform:translate(0, 0)}}.post-title{font-size:1rem;color:#ED9455;padding:1rem 0 0.5rem 0;border:none;font-weight:600}.days{color:#ed8755;font-weight:600;margin-bottom:0;margin-top:0.2rem}.post-txt{line-height:1rem;font-size:0.9375rem}h3:after,.subSection-title:after{border:none}.article_data{margin:0 0.2rem}.about{margin:2rem 0}.about .about-txt{text-align:center;letter-spacing:0.06rem;line-height:1.6}.kosuge{display:flex;margin:2rem auto}.kosuge .kosuge-img{width:30%}.kosuge .kosuge-img img{width:100%}.price{margin:0 auto;text-align:center}.price img{width:40%}.slick-slide{height:auto !important}.slick-track{display:flex;align-items:center}.footer_illust{text-align:right}